Analysis: Bitcoin is trapped in a $85,000–90,000 "waiting period," with Christmas volatility potentially driven by options expiration

2025-12-24 20:09:50

Cryptanalysis expert Michaël van de Poppe posted on the X platform that Bitcoin has been hovering between $85,000 and $90,000 for several weeks, and now it's a waiting game, with capital only likely to flow back into the cryptocurrency market after U.S. stocks reach local highs.

Market analysis suggests that historically, Bitcoin tends to experience fluctuations of 5% to 7% during the Christmas period, a pattern usually related to year-end options expirations rather than new fundamental catalysts. Data shows that approximately 300,000 Bitcoin options contracts (worth $23.7 billion) and 446,000 IBIT options contracts are set to expire this Friday.
